首页 视频教程 毕业设计 面试宝典 文档教程 技术文章 学习工具 在线提问

Java零基础入门到高级进阶

Java零基础入门到高级进阶
课程下载
课程简介

课程目标:通过学习本教程,让大家真正地零基础入门Java,为后续Java技术的学习奠定扎实基础。 适用人群:本教程适合绝对零基础的学员或者是转行学习Java开发的人员学习,每一个知识点都讲解的非常细腻,由浅入深,循序渐进,绝对让你有所收获。 本套视频适合绝对Java零基础的小白学习,课程内容详细程度前无古人,每个知识点以“掰开了揉碎了”的方式讲解,本视频基于JDK最新版本15进行讲解,主要包括Java核心语法、Java程序运行内存分析、Java面向对象等内容,虽然本视频是专门为小白量身打造,但是课程在每一个知识点上进行了很大的延伸,深度完全完胜三年工作经验的程序员,为您以后的发展奠定坚实的基础。

课程目录
•001.我们要学什么目标是啥
•002.什么是计算机
•003.计算机的组成
•004.什么是计算机编程语言
•005.计算机语言发展史之机器语言
•006.计算机语言发展史之低级语言
•007.计算机语言发展史之高级语言
•008.Java可以开发什么类型的软件
•009.Java语言发展史之名字来历
•010.Java语言发展史之详细时间轴
•011.Java语言特性之简单性
•012.Java语言特性之健壮性
•013.Java语言特性之多线程
•014.Java语言特性之安全性
•015.Java语言特性之可移植性
•016.Java的加载与执行
•017.jdk16的下载
•018.jdk16的安装
•019.path环境变量的配置
•020.编写第一个java程序
•021.编译第一个java程序
•022.运行第一个java程序
•023.classpath环境变量
•024.java中的注释
•025.public class和class的区别
•026.什么是标识符
•027.标识符可以标识什么
•028.标识符命名规则
•029.判断哪些标识符是合法的
•030.标识符的命名规范
•031.阿里巴巴Java开发规约泰山版
•032.Java中的关键字
•033.Java中的字面值
•034.Java中的字面值
•035.什么是二进制
•036.二进制转换成十进制
•037.计算机底层是采用二进制的方式存储
•038.十进制转换成二进制
•039.使用计算器也可以进行进制转换
•040.什么是字符集
•041.什么是编码和解码
•042.字符集都有哪些
•043.乱码是如何产生的
•044.什么是变量
•045.变量的声明
•046.变量的赋值
•047.变量的重新赋值
•048.变量声明的同时赋值
•049.变量名不能重名
•050.方法体中代码执行顺序
•051.一行上声明多个变量
•052.变量的作用域
•053.变量的分类
•054.数据类型概述
•055.Java中数据类型包括哪些
•056.每个数据类型怎么称呼
•057.字节及容量换算单位
•058.关于二进制的符号位
•059.八种基本数据类型取值范围
•060.八种基本数据类型默认值
•061.整数类型之自动类型转换
•062.经典面试题
•063.整数型字面量的几种表示形式
•064.强制类型转换
•065.强制类型转换有时会损失精度
•066.基本数据类型转换规则1
•067.基本数据类型转换规则2
•068.基本数据类型转换规则3
•069.二进制的原码反码补码
•070.推导精度损失之后的数据是多少
•071.浮点型概述
•072.浮点型字面量默认被当做double
•073.经典面试题
•074.浮点型数据在内存中怎么存的
•075.IEEE754标准
•076.经典面试题解读
•077.不建议使用双等号判断两个浮点型是否相等
•078.多种数据类型混合运算规则
•079.布尔类型值只有true和false
•080.布尔类型用在哪里
•081.char可以存储一个汉字
•082.使用char的注意事项
•083.关于char的面试题
•084.转义字符制表符
•085.其他转义字符
•086.怎么输出1个和2个普通反斜杠
•087.字符的unicode编码
•088.什么是运算符
•089.运算符的分类
•090.各种运算符介绍
•091.接收用户键盘输入
•092.接收键盘输入浮点型数据
•093.接收键盘输入字符串
•094.算术运算符
•095.接收键盘输入和算术运算符综合应用
•096.算术运算符之++
•097.#NAME?
•098.诡异的面试题
•099.如何查看类的字节码
•100.栈数据结构详解
•101.局部变量在内存中具体如何存储
•102.从字节码角度分析诡异的面试题
•103.关系运算符
课程资料
视频教程 配套源码 学习笔记 学习工具 免费下载 学习文档
下载方法
获取本套教程

①扫描右侧二维码关注公众号

②回复消息【学习】

③获取本套课程免费下载链接

获取全套教程

①扫描右侧二维码关注公众号

②回复消息免费课程

③获取全套课程免费下载链接

扫码关注公众号

/jishuwenzhang/JavaSE/IntelliJ_IDEA/222.html

盘点常用IntelliJ IDEA快捷键

IntelliJ IDEA作为java编程语言开发的集成环境,在业界被公认为最好的java开发工具,也是大多数java程序员会使用的开发集成环境。IDEA使用起来十分方便,在这样一个基础上,如果使用了...

北大青鸟支持你成为一位受人尊重的专业人才
/jishuwenzhang/JavaSE/JDK/180.html

Hadoop环境搭建安装JDK

判断是否安装了jdk 使用java-version和java命令判断是否安装了jdk [root@localhost .ssh]# java -version-bash: java: command not found[root@localhost .ssh]# javac-bash: javac: command not found[root@localhost .ssh]# 以上任何一...

北大青鸟支持你成为一位受人尊重的专业人才
/jishuwenzhang/JavaSE/JDK/197.html

JDK安装教程介绍

JDK的英文全称是Java Development Kit,从字面意思翻译过来就是java开发的工具。不管是学习java编程,还是要搭建jsp web开发环境,或者是android开发环境都离不开JDK,所以我们首先来学习 JD...

北大青鸟支持你成为一位受人尊重的专业人才
/jishuwenzhang/JavaSE/weifuwu/SpringBoot/2418.html

spring boot视频教程学什么

Spring Boot是一个全新的框架,是用来简化Spring应用的初始搭建及开发过程的,可以使用特定的方式来进行配置,可使得开发人员不在需要定义样板化的配置,所以,Spring boot能够大大简化...

北大青鸟支持你成为一位受人尊重的专业人才
/jishuwenzhang/JavaSE/weifuwu/Docker/2463.html

Docker学习视频,免费下载学习

Docker是一个使用Go语言开发的开源的应用容器引擎,让开发者可以打包他们的应用以及依赖到一个可移植的容器中,然后发布到任何流行的机器上。Docker的迅猛发展和全新理念,席卷了...

北大青鸟支持你成为一位受人尊重的专业人才
/jishuwenzhang/JavaSE/weifuwu/Docker/2464.html

Docker视频下载,适合零基础入门学习

Docker是一个使用Go语言开发的开源的应用容器引擎,让开发者可以打包他们的应用以及依赖到一个可移植的容器中,然后发布到任何流行的机器上。Docker的迅猛发展和全新理念,席卷了...

北大青鸟支持你成为一位受人尊重的专业人才
/jishuwenzhang/JavaSE/weifuwu/Docker/2465.html

Docker视频教程,初学者通俗易懂

Docker是一个使用Go语言开发的开源的应用容器引擎,让开发者可以打包他们的应用以及依赖到一个可移植的容器中,然后发布到任何流行的机器上。Docker的迅猛发展和全新理念,席卷了...

北大青鸟支持你成为一位受人尊重的专业人才
/jishuwenzhang/JavaSE/weifuwu/Docker/2446.html

退出Docker容器的方法

想要退出 docker容器 ?您有多种选择可供选择。 您可以从交互式会话中分离以让容器在后台运行,也可以退出它。让我们看看两者。 如果您使用以下内容启动容器,这很重要: docker ru...

北大青鸟支持你成为一位受人尊重的专业人才
版权所有北大青鸟慧浦教育